比特币作为一种去中心化的数字货币,自诞生以来就以其独特的属性和应用场景吸引了无数人的关注,在比特币的世界里,交易是其核心功能之一,而单笔最大交易额度则是衡量其网络吞吐能力和安全性的重要指标,我们就来聊聊比特币单笔最大交易的那些事儿。
比特币的交易机制
在深入了解比特币单笔最大交易之前,我们先得了解一下比特币的交易机制,比特币网络中的交易是通过区块链技术来记录和验证的,每笔交易都会被打包进一个区块,然后通过挖矿过程被添加到区块链上,每个区块的大小是有限的,最初设定为1MB,这就意味着每个区块能够包含的交易数量是有限的。
单笔最大交易的计算
比特币单笔最大交易额度是如何计算的呢?这涉及到区块大小和交易数据大小的关系,每笔比特币交易至少需要包含以下信息:
1、交易输入:指示比特币从哪里来,通常包括前一笔交易的输出和签名。
2、交易输出:指示比特币将到哪里去,包括接收者的比特币地址和金额。
3、交易费:支付给矿工的费用,用于激励他们将交易打包进区块。
由于每个区块的大小有限,因此单笔交易的数据大小不能超过区块大小,理论上,单笔交易的最大数据大小取决于区块大小和交易中包含的签名、地址等信息的大小,为了确保网络的稳定性和效率,实际的单笔交易数据大小通常会小于区块大小。
区块大小的限制
最初,比特币的区块大小被设定为1MB,这在当时看来是足够的,但随着比特币用户数量的增加和交易量的增长,1MB的区块大小逐渐显得捉襟见肘,为了解决这个问题,比特币社区提出了多种解决方案,包括增加区块大小、实施隔离见证(Segregated Witness,简称SegWit)等。
SegWit是一种改进协议,它通过将签名数据从交易数据中分离出来,从而减少了每个交易所需的数据大小,使得每个区块能够包含更多的交易,实施SegWit后,比特币的区块大小实际上可以扩展到约2MB。
单笔最大交易的实践
在实际操作中,单笔最大交易的额度还受到其他因素的影响,比如交易费率,在比特币网络拥堵时,矿工会优先选择交易费率较高的交易进行打包,如果一笔交易的交易费率较低,即使其数据大小在理论上可以被打包进区块,实际上也可能因为网络拥堵而无法及时被确认。
比特币网络的参与者也会考虑到交易的安全性和隐私性,一笔交易如果包含多个输入和输出,可能会增加被追踪的风险,一些用户可能会选择将大额交易分成多个小额交易来执行,以提高隐私性。
比特币的扩展性问题
随着比特币网络的发展,其扩展性问题逐渐成为社区关注的焦点,为了提高比特币网络的处理能力,一些解决方案被提出并实施,比如闪电网络(Lightning Network),闪电网络是一种二层支付协议,它允许用户在比特币主链之外进行快速、低成本的交易,通过这种方式,比特币网络可以处理更多的交易,而不需要增加单个区块的大小。
单笔最大交易的未来
随着技术的发展和社区的创新,比特币单笔最大交易的额度有望进一步提升,通过实施更高效的交易压缩技术、改进区块打包机制等,比特币网络的吞吐能力将得到增强,随着比特币网络的参与者对交易隐私和安全性要求的提高,单笔最大交易的额度也可能会受到更多的关注和调整。
比特币单笔最大交易的额度是一个动态变化的指标,它受到区块大小、交易数据大小、交易费率等多种因素的影响,随着比特币网络的不断发展和技术的进步,我们有理由相信,比特币单笔最大交易的额度将得到进一步的提升,以满足日益增长的交易需求,比特币社区也在不断探索新的解决方案,以提高网络的扩展性和安全性,确保比特币作为一种数字货币的长期稳定和健康发展。